Web app "Web Connection Failed" — camera never sends SDP_ANSWER over KVS WebRTC (captured the signaling)

Two of my cameras won’t load in the web app at my.wyze.com and show “Web Connection Failed.” Both stream fine in the mobile app. Rather than guess, I captured the WebRTC signaling from the browser side, and the result is specific enough that I think it’s worth posting — the browser is doing everything correctly and the camera simply never answers. SETUP Cameras that FAIL in the web app: Cam A — model WYZEC1-JZ (Cam v2), firmware 4.9.9.3006 Cam B — model HL_CFL2, firmware 4.53.11.7154 Cameras that WORK, in the same tab, on the same network, at the same moment: Cam C — model HL_CFL2, firmware 4.53.11.7154 Cam D — model WYZE_CAKP2JFUS Cam E — model HL_PAN2 Cam C is the same model and the same firmware as Cam B and works fine, so this isn’t a model or firmware issue. It’s per-device. Browser: Chrome 152 on macOS, tested with a brand new empty profile — no extensions, no cached cookies — to rule out anything on my end. WHAT ACTUALLY HAPPENS The web app streams over AWS Kinesis Video WebRTC. For every camera, the get-streams API call succeeds and returns a valid signaling URL, ICE servers, and auth token — including for the two that fail. The browser then opens the KVS signaling WebSocket (handshake succeeds, HTTP 101), sends a well-formed SDP offer, and gathers a full set of ICE candidates: host, server-reflexive, and TURN relay.
